New Zealand is considering emergency powers not used since 1979 to force motorists to nominate one day per week where they cannot use their vehicle, with hefty fines for non-compliance. Australia is introducing blended fuel to address the current petrol crisis, while storing only 30-35 days of fuel compared to the IEA recommendation of 90 days.
